J.P. Morgan Asset Management is making significant strides in its real estate division by appointing Chad Tredway as the new Global Head of Real Estate. This strategic move aims to capitalize on generational opportunities within the real estate market, reflecting the firm’s commitment to expanding its investment capabilities and expertise in this sector.
Chad Tredway brings a wealth of experience and a proven track record in real estate investments, having previously held senior positions within the industry. His leadership is expected to drive innovation and enhance the firm’s portfolio management strategies, allowing for more robust investment decisions that align with evolving market dynamics.
The appointment of Tredway comes at a time when real estate continues to present unique opportunities, particularly in areas such as sustainable development and urban revitalization. J.P. Morgan Asset Management is poised to leverage these trends under Tredway’s guidance, aiming to deliver long-term value to its clients and stakeholders. This transition marks a pivotal moment for the firm as it seeks to strengthen its position in the competitive real estate landscape.
